Original Description
The Kinderportrait by Kurt Scheele exudes a tender yet enigmatic charm, capturing childhood innocence through a refined yet subtly stylized approach. Scheele (1898-1945), a German painter of the early modernist period, blends Neue Sachlichkeit (New Objectivity) influences with delicate realism, evident in the portrait’s meticulous rendering of textures—soft curls of hair, gauzy fabrics—against restrained yet atmospheric lighting. Unlike the overtly critical tone of many interwar portraits, Scheele’s work leans toward poetic introspection, positioning it uniquely within Weimar-era art. Though less documented than contemporaries like Dix or Beckmann, his Kinderportrait reflects a quieter resistance to expressionist turbulence, prioritizing psychological depth over societal critique. Its historical value lies in bridging late Romantic sentiment with modernist precision, making it a poignant testament to early 20th-century European portraiture.
